Transaction 59d85c90ffd31d81a829cae322ff76d81b2acf2c9c40e2dc0384c8dbac00683b
1 Input
2 Outputs
- 59d85c90ffd31d81a829cae322ff76d81b2acf2c9c40e2dc0384c8dbac00683b:0
- 59d85c90ffd31d81a829cae322ff76d81b2acf2c9c40e2dc0384c8dbac00683b:1
value 60000
address 1DtwoUpcktRbGsRtWLaQjLbzQQENJKREYB
value 578
address 13Tt8X2QdmRXSfkXPjiC5x7F2ip8v48JAN